The Centre for Policy Studies was established in 1974 by Margaret Thatcher and Keith Joseph to serve as a ‘think-tank’ for the Conservative Party.
Jones was invited to join as a Director in 1983 and was formally voted on to the Board the following year. He stood down in 1988. Jones also served on two of the Centre’s Study Groups, those on Defence, which he chaired, and Education.

Michael Whiteman joined the SPR in 1953, and was made an honorary member in 1999. His first publication in the field of psychical experience was on angelic choirs in The Hibbert Journal of 1954. In 1956 he published his first paper in the JSPR on separative (out-of-body) experience. His diaries record over 7000 such experiences, which commenced around the age of five.
